Problem: A professor was teaching multiple sections
of the same course, they were interested in combining the sections in Blackboard
so that there was only one Blackboard course site to manage for all of the
sections.
Solution: Instructors are able to merge their courses
themselves through Blackboard. To do so they should go into the site in which
they would like to manage from, or use for teaching. In the control panel, then
should click on “Course Tools” > “Merge Course Enrollments”. (Screen shot of Merge Course Enrollments) In the “Instructor Course Merge
Module” page, the instructor should click on the link for “Merge Section
Enrollments Into this Course” From there it will have you create a name for the
parent course and then select the courses or sections you would like to add to
the parent course. All of the students will be copies from the child courses
into the parent course going forward automatically. In the Grade Center of the
parent (main) course, you can now see which original section the student was in
before the merge as a reference.
Note: The merge
function merges in the students from the child courses but does not merge or
copy course material itself. You will need to post the course material you wish
to distribute in the main parent course manually as you normally would, or use
the course copy function to copy material from one course site to another as
desired.
